Welcome to the European Institute for Outdoor Adventure Education and Experiential Learning (EOE).

The organisation functions with the support of the European Community budget line "Support for international non-governmental youth organisations"

Founded in 1996 the European Institute is a non-governmental association registered at the magistrates` court of Marburg in Germany.

In Europe the organisation has 345individual members and 82 organisations from 23 countries. (January 2006)

Its purposes are as follows:

- Development of an European Network between youngsters, social and youth workers, teachers, educators, academics and students concerning Outdoor Adventure Education and Experiential Learning

- Realisation of projects especially youth projects in the field of Outdoor Adventure Education and Experiential Learning

- Organisation of European Conferences

- Distribution of Information

- Research on the theory of Outdoor Adventure Education to promote the quality of practice

- Implementation of research projects and best practices

- Development of professional standards
